M1Muppet, the UK's Aircraft Accident Investigation Board (AAIB) knew you would be asking this question, and so very thoughtfully published the results of an inquiry into a Hawker Hurricane accident in their November accident bulletin. Apart from the obvious benefit of understanding how other people got into accident or incident scenarios, there is a great summary on some of the factors behind ground looping and dealing with a crosswind in a tail dragger. Well worth a read, and it will encourage you to find out where your tail dragger's C of G sits!
